Hi, I am a greenhorn of Java. Please help me.
I am using Tomcat as my servlet container, and I create a web application under the directory of
"$TomcatHome$/webapp". All the Jsps run well, but when I put a servlet under "/WEB-INF/classes" and run it, I meet an error: "The requested resource (/jsp10/servlet/srv_intro) is not available".
I have specified the context for this web application in server.xml.
Waiting for your help.
